Roles and Responsibilities
As a Client Advocacy Coordinator, your impact on the organization is seen through your management of a seamless transition of documents as they are received by the organization and then processed through to other positions. You provide clients with guidance, assistance, and support for routine insurance-related questions. At renewal time, you work closely with the team to collect enrollment information and organize benefit packages to help employees gain access to critical benefits, including health insurance, dental and vision coverage, life insurance, disability insurance, etc.

The Work Environment, Physical Demands, and Travel
Your work is conducted primarily at the Lewer Administrative Offices. On occasion, your work may be conducted at a remote location, such as a home office. You must be able to remain in a stationary position 75% of the time, and be able to occasionally move about inside the office to access filing cabinets, office machinery, etc. You will operate a computer and other office productivity machinery, such as a calculator, copy machine, and computer printer 95% of the time. You will need to be able to lift to 20 lbs. Travel is required for this seat and is less than 5%.
